**Ticket: Pool config drift on Brindlewood replicas**

Hey — quick one for security review. Two of the Brindlewood database replicas are running pool settings that don't match what's in the repo. Someone hand-edited max connections and disabled TLS re-validation on idle reuse, which is the part we'd like your eyes on. Here's what's actually live on those boxes right now.

service settings:
[casax]
port = 6379
team = rusir
host = casax.zemvarhq.corp
region = outer-4
access_code = ac_9808ce
timeout_ms = 1500

Handover: Audit-Log Viewer (Lanternview)

Taking over from Priya's rotation. Support team: the viewer runs on the Kestrel cluster and reads from the immutable event store; filters are cached for ten minutes, so recent entries may lag. If the export job stalls, restart the worker pool before escalating. Admin access is gated behind the ops vault, which occasionally locks itself after failed sync attempts. If that happens, you can restore access using the recovery passphrase below.

vault phrase of bagaf-kajeg = jorath-feniel-briir-siliel-ralix

## Build Provenance: PoolCore

PoolCore manages database connection pooling for the Larkspur platform. Every release is built by the Tindall pipeline; no local builds are accepted. Pool sizing defaults live in the baked config, so verifying which build you're running matters before debugging exhaustion errors. Check the artifact manifest first. The provenance token for the current release is shown below.

session token of kageg-tahop = htk14_af3c1ccccb7dcf

- [ ] Step 7: Archive cold storage buckets (Glacierline tier). Confirm both ceremony witnesses are present, verify bucket manifests match the Oxbow ledger, then seal the archive key shares. Plugin authors may observe but not handle shares. Once sealed, the archive index itself is encrypted and can only be reopened with the passphrase below.

vault phrase of badup-hahig = tamael-aldael-kelmir-istael-fenok-istwyn-tamius-jorath-oliion